Vogelsang Left With Crumbs

Level 19 : 6,000/12,000, 2,000 ante

Christoph Vogelsang open-jammed from the small blind and Furkat Rakhimov put himself at risk, calling out of the big blind.

Vogelsang: {q-Diamonds}{k-Clubs}
Rakhimov: {6-Clubs}{6-Diamonds}

Rakhimov was racing for his tournament life and would score the double up on a {2-Spades}{5-Spades}{j-Diamonds}{j-Hearts}{5-Clubs} board. Vogelsang was forced to match Rakhimov's stack worth 169,000 leaving himself with less than six big blinds.
